+PCAP:
+
+U-boot supports live ethernet packet capture in PCAP(2.4) format.
+This is enabled by CONFIG_CMD_PCAP.
+
+The capture is stored on physical memory, and should be copied to
+a machine capabale of parsing and displaying PCAP files (IE. wireshark)
+If networking works properly one can copy the capture file from physical memory
+using tftpput, or save it to local storage with (sf write, mmc write, fatwrite, etc)
+
+the pcap capturing requires maximum buffer size.
+when the buffer is full, packets will silently drop.
+check the status using "pcap status" to see if the buffer is full,
+if so, consider increasing the buffer size.

+Usage example:
+
+# pcap init 0x100000 100000
+PCAP capture initialized: addr: 0xffffffff80100000 max length: 100000
+
+# pcap start
+# env set ipaddr 10.0.2.15; env set serverip 10.0.2.2; tftp uImage64
+eth0 at 10000000: PHY present at 0
+eth0 at 10000000: link up, 1000Mbps full-duplex (lpa: 0x7c00)
+Using eth0 at 10000000 device
+TFTP from server 10.0.2.2; our IP address is 10.0.2.15
+Filename 'uImage64'.
+Load address: 0xffffffff88000000
+Loading: #################################################################
+ #################################################################
+ #################################################################
+ #################################################################
+ #################################################################
+ #################################################################
+ #################################################################
+ #################################################################
+ #################################################################
+ #
+ 18.2 MiB/s
+done
+Bytes transferred = 8359376 (7f8dd0 hex)
+PCAP status:
+ Initialized addr: 0xffffffff80100000 max length: 100000
+ Status: Active. file size: 99991
+ Incoming packets: 66 Outgoing packets: 67
+ !!! Buffer is full, consider increasing buffer size !!!
+
+
+# pcap stop
+# tftpput 0xffffffff80100000 100000 10.0.2.2:capture.pcap
